ABOUT UNLEASH THE ROAR!

Unleash the Roar! (UTR!) − is a national movement jointly led by SportSG and the插件 Football Association of Singapore (FAS) aimed at raising the level of Singapore football, build strong support systems to nurture our next generation of talents, and rally the nation towards sporting excellence. It is a long‑term, whole‑of‑society effort covering grassroots development, elite youth pathways, infrastructure and community / fan engagement.

As the Head of Academy for Pathway Development, Women’s Football, you will report to the Director of Football (UTR!). Your main responsibilities include the development and implementation of football pathways for the girls programme in the National Development Center (NDC), the Junior National Development Center (JNDC), and the School Football Academy (SFA), working in close collaboration with key partners such as MOE, schools, clubs, and national agencies. You will be in charge of the development and delivery, quality and continuous improvement of the overall UTR! girls’ programme at an elite level. You will drive strategic initiatives that integrate football and academic development from grassroots to elite levels, andోద develop the technical / tactical skills required to implement the Football Association of Singapore (FAS) National Playing Philosophy. Together with Director of Football (UTR!), you will also plan, design, organise and conduct Coaches’ Continuous Education (CCE)зем courses for youth coaches for female football in the Singapore football ecosystem.

Your other key job responsibilities are detailed below. You will also support other UTR! teams / initiatives where appropriate and Communication required.

JOB DESCRIPTION
Program Development and Implementation

To develop and implement a comprehensive youth female program for UTR! in line with the Singapore National Football Curriculum and Football Philosophy.

Training and Instruction

To oversee the planning and execution of training sessions, ensuring they are well‑structured and cater to the specific needs of each player.

Physical Conditioning

To work with the UTR!’s physio and sport science team to develop strength and conditioning programmes specific to youth female football to ensure the players are physically prepared for the demands of the position, working on agility, strength, and conditioning.

Communication and Collaboration

To oversee stakeholder engagement with MOE, FAS, CoachSG, schools, and clubs to ensure alignment and collaboration. To maintain regular and open communications with parents, keeping them informed about UTR!’s program and players' progress.

Individual Development Plan

To work with the UTR! sports science team to create assessment criteria for the individual development plans of UTR!’s female players in the Athlete Management System (AMS).

Recruitment and Evaluation

To work with Director of Football (UTR!) on the scouting and evaluation plan of potential talent, and to disseminate this to UTR! Coaches.

REQUIREMENTS
  • Minimum certification: Asian Football Confederation (AFC) A Diploma or equivalent
  • Previous experience of working with high performance football young athletes/children in a similar role
  • Good network with the local football women’s coaches fraternity
  • Experience in leading a team of more than 3 staff members
  • Has worked in a high‑performance environment
  • Understands Long‑Term Athlete Development principles
  • High level of communication skills (written & spoken)
  • Good command of English (written & spoken)
  • Good team player who can work on own initiative
  • Valid National Registry of Coaches (NROC) membership دیت required
  • Knowledge in and familiarity with football analysis, video and tactical software
  • Computer skills
